MEASUREMENT OF ROOT CANAL LENGTH - USE OF AN ELECTROMETRIC DEVICE.
S C Anand1, B P Khattak2, V P Sachdeva3
1Professor and Head, Pune 411 040.
Medical Journal, Armed Forces India
|August 10, 2017
Summary
The odontometer accurately measures root canal length, improving pulpectomy success. This device significantly reduced post-operative complications compared to conventional methods.
Area of Science:
- Dentistry
- Endodontics
- Dental Technology
Background:
- Accurate root canal length measurement is crucial for successful pulpectomy.
- Conventional manual and radiographic techniques for determining root canal length have limitations in accuracy.
Purpose of the Study:
- To evaluate the efficacy of an odontometer for measuring root canal length.
- To compare the outcomes of pulpectomy using an odontometer versus conventional methods.
Main Methods:
- Pulpectomy was performed on 36 teeth using conventional methods (Group A).
- Pulpectomy was performed on 51 teeth using an odontometer for root canal length measurement (Group B).
Main Results:
- The odontometer provided rapid and accurate root canal length measurements.
- Group B, utilizing the odontometer, exhibited significantly fewer post-operative complications (p < 0.05) compared to Group A.
Conclusions:
- The odontometer is an effective tool for precise root canal length determination.
- Using an odontometer in pulpectomy leads to improved clinical outcomes and reduced complications.
